Average Personal Care and Service Occupations Salary in Hinesville, GA

In Hinesville, GA, professionals in Personal Care and Service Occupations can expect an average annual salary of $30,880. This figure is notably below the national average of $39,260, suggesting that local economic factors and demand dynamics play a significant role in compensation within this sector in the region.

Executive Summary

  • Average Salary: $30,880 per year.
  •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 28.2% over the last 5 years.
  •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$45,720.
  • Outlook: The Personal Care and Service Occupations sector in Hinesville, GA, comprises a local workforce of 370 individuals. With a location quotient of 0.89, the concentration of these roles is slightly below the national average, indicating a stable but not exceptionally high demand relative to other occupations in the area.

Personal Care and Service Occupations Salary Distribution in Hinesville, GA

Salary progression within Personal Care and Service Occupations in Hinesville, GA, typically scales with experience. Entry-level positions often start at the lower end of the pay scale, while senior roles and those with specialized skills command higher compensation, with percentile gaps illustrating clear career advancement opportunities.

Experience LevelMarket PercentileAnnual WageHourly Rate
Entry LevelStarting career. Focus on acquiring core skills.10% (Entry)$21,100$10.1
ExperiencedProficient professional working independently.25% (Junior)$23,160$11.1
Mid-LevelEstablished expert. Standard market value.50% (Median)$28,120$13.5
Senior LevelAdvanced skills, leadership or specialist role.75% (Senior)$38,600$18.6
Top TierIndustry leader / Executive level compensation.90% (Expert)$45,720$22
